Role Description
This is a full-time Commercial Lines Director role at Bethany Insurance Agency located in San Dimas, CA. The Commercial Lines Director will be responsible for analytical business planning, commercial lines business management, and team management. This role involves overseeing commercial insurance department operations.
The desired candidate will possess strong management skills, extensive knowledge of commercial lines insurance, and the ability to drive departmental performance and client satisfaction.
This position pays uncapped commission, bonus, and profit share on top of the base pay.
Responsibilities
- Lead and manage the Commercial Lines Department, providing guidance, mentorship, and performance evaluations to team members.
- Oversee the servicing and growth of a commercial lines book of business, ensuring client retention and satisfaction.
- Foster strong relationships with clients, addressing their needs and concerns promptly and effectively.
- Ensure the department operates efficiently and complies with company policies and industry regulations.
- Develop and implement strategies to achieve departmental goals, including revenue growth and operational efficiency.
- Train and develop staff to enhance their skills and knowledge, ensuring high performance and professional growth.
- Address and resolve complex issues related to client accounts and departmental operations.
- Work closely with other departments to ensure seamless integration of services and optimal client experience.
- Prepare and present regular reports on departmental performance, including financial metrics and client satisfaction levels.
